The Transdermal Patch and Sustained-Release Delivery
Butec is supplied in the unique dosage form of a transdermal patch or system, a matrix-type preparation designed for the transdermal route of administration. This method is a key differentiating factor, intended for patients requiring a stable, non-oral analgesic regimen. The patch is engineered for sustained-release, facilitating the continuous, steady absorption of Buprenorphine through the skin over several days. This delivery method is designed to provide stable, consistent plasma concentrations compared to intermittent dosing. The controlled nature of this delivery system prevents the rapid fluctuations often associated with traditional oral analgesics.
Pharmacological Classification and General Purpose
The Buprenorphine in Butec is specifically characterized as a partial opioid agonist and an opioid receptor modulator. This classification means that while it strongly binds to the mu-opioid receptor—the primary target for analgesia—it activates it only partially, which distinguishes its pharmacological profile from pure agonists. The overarching general purpose of this partial agonist action is to deliver continuous analgesia, which is the primary therapeutic goal in managing unrelenting chronic pain conditions.
